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A stringing device and stringing method usable for manufacturing photovoltaic modules efficiently with an easy configuration, and a photovoltaic module manufacturing device and manufacturing method. A stringing device for electrically connecting electrodes formed respectively in adjacent photovoltaic cells via a conductive member includes: number one joining unit which joins the photovoltaic cell supplied with its light receiving surface facing up and the conductive member to each other; and number two joining unit which joins the photovoltaic cell supplied with its light receiving surface facing down and the conductive member to each other.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

The invention claimed is: 1. A stringing device for electrically connecting electrodes formed respectively in photovoltaic cells via a conductive member, comprising: a number one joining unit which joins a first photovoltaic cell supplied with its light receiving surface facing up to a first conductive member; a number two joining unit which joins a second photovoltaic cell supplied with its light receiving surface facing down to a second conductive member; a number one cell conveyance unit and a number two cell conveyance unit which convey respectively in the X direction the first photovoltaic cell joined to the first conductive member and the second photovoltaic cell joined to the second conductive member; a number one cell stand and a number two cell stand provided respectively next to the number one and number two cell conveyance units; a moving device which moves one of the first photovoltaic and second photovoltaic cells conveyed by one of the number one and number two cell conveyance units to one of the number one and number two cell stands; and an inverting-and-moving device which rotates around an axis line parallel to the X direction to move and invert the other one of the first photovoltaic and second photovoltaic cells conveyed by the other of the number one and number two cell conveyance units to the other of the number one and number two cell stands. 2. The stringing device according to claim 1 , wherein the first photovoltaic cell conveyed by the number one cell conveyance unit is moved to the number one cell stand without inverting by using the moving device, and the second photovoltaic cell conveyed by the number two cell conveyance unit is moved to the number two cell stand in an inverted state by the inverting-and-moving device. 3. The stringing device according to claim 1 , wherein the respective first and second conductive members have a length which straddles adjacent photovoltaic cells, an edge of the respective first and second conductive members is joined to one of the positive electrode or negative electrode of a first adjacent photovoltaic cell, and the other edge of the conductive member is joined to the other of either the negative electrode or positive electrode of a second adjacent photovoltaic cells. 4. The stringing device according to claim 1 , wherein the number one and number two joining units join the respective first and second conductive members and the respective first and second photovoltaic cells by pressing while applying heat using hot plates. 5. The stringing device according to claim 4 , wherein the respective first and second conductive members and the respective first and second photovoltaic cells are joined via flux. 6. The stringing device according to claim 4 , wherein the number one and number two cell conveyance units comprise a cooling station arranged in the X direction which cools the respective first and second photovoltaic cells to which the respective first and second conductive members have been joined by each of the hot plates of the number one and number two joining units.
